`

char 和String的转换问题?

 
阅读更多
下面程序的结果为?
public class String_to_char {
 
	public static void main(String[] args) {
		 String s = "hello";
         char ch[] = s.toCharArray();      
        
         String s1 = new String(ch);         
         System.out.println("\n"+s1);
         
         if(s1.equals(s)){
        	 System.out.print(true);
         }else
        	 System.out.print(false);
     
        
         if(s.equals(ch)){        
        	 System.out.print("true");
         }else{
        	 System.out.print("false");    
         }
         
         char a1[] ={'h','e','l','l','o'}; 
         if(ch.equals(a1)){
        	 System.out.print("true");
         }else{
        	 System.out.print("false");  
         }
         
         
         
	}

}
分享到:
评论

相关推荐

    C#中char[]与string之间的转换 string 转换成 Char[]

    今天,我们将探讨C#中char[]与string之间的转换,包括string转换成Char[]和Char[]转换成string,同时也会涉及到byte[]与string之间的转换。 首先,让我们来看一下string转换成Char[]。在C#中,我们可以使用...

    java中int_char_string三种类型的相互转换

    Java 中 int、char、String 三种类型的相互转换详解 Java 作为一种静态类型语言,对变量的类型定义非常严格。然而,在实际开发中,我们经常需要在不同的类型之间进行转换以满足不同的需求。其中,int、char、String...

    string和char*

    string、CString 和 char* 之间可以通过构造函数和赋值运算符相互转换。 * string 可以从 CString 和 char* 构造。 * CString 可以从 char* 构造。 * char* 可以赋值给 string 和 CString。 运算符 string、...

    C# char[]与string byte[]与string之间的转换详解

    1、char[]与string之间的转换 //string 转换成 Char[] string str=hello; char[] arr=str.ToCharArray(); //Char[] 转换成 string string str1 = new string(arr); 2、byte[]与string之间的转化 string str = 你好...

    CString,int,string,char之间的转换(C/C++)

    反之,将string转换为char类型可以使用c_str函数,例如: ``` string s = "a"; char c = s.c_str()[0]; ``` 六、int与string之间的转换 int可以使用to_string函数将int类型转换为string,例如: ``` int i = 64; ...

    float_char_int_string.rar_char float_char int 转换_char to string_

    总之,理解和熟练掌握`char`, `float`, `int`, `string`之间的转换是编程基础的重要部分,它能帮助我们更有效地处理不同数据类型的数据,确保程序的正确性和灵活性。在实际编程过程中,应根据需求选择合适的转换方法...

    CString,string,char*之间的转换

    string的c_str()也是非常常用的,但要注意和char *转换时,要把char定义成为const char*,这样是最安全的。 以上函数UNICODE编码也没问题:unicode下照用,加个_T()宏就行了,像这样子_T("%s") 补充: CString ...

    C++类型转换(char* string cstring unicode ansi )转换

    C++类型转换(char* string cstring unicode ansi 等等)转换 C++类型转换是指在C++编程语言中,各种类型之间的转换操作。这种转换操作包括基本类型之间的转换、字符串类型之间的转换、字符类型之间的转换等等。在...

    C++中string转换为char*类型返回后乱码问题解决

    Serialize1(TreeNode *root) 其函数返回类型为char*,但是我在实现的过程中为了更方便的操作添加字符串使用的是C++中string类型的变量,这就导致我最后得到的结果res是string类型,若是要返回需要转化为char *类型...

    delphi中String,PChar,PByte,Array of Char,Array of Byte 互相转换

    通过上述示例代码,我们可以看到在 Delphi 中,String、PChar、PByte、Array of Char 和 Array of Byte 之间的转换是非常直观的。然而,在实际应用中需要注意一些细节,例如: - 当使用指针时,确保它们指向的有效...

    string、cstring 、char* 转化问题

    本文将详细介绍 string、CString 和 char* 之间的转化问题,并提供了-six种不同的转化方法。 首先,让我们了解一下这三种类型的特点。CString 是基于 MFC 的一种字符串类型,安全性最高,但可移植性最差。string 是...

    通过string转换比较好些,很多重载函数要么是char * ,要么是String

    在探讨字符串处理的过程中,我们经常会遇到不同的数据类型之间的转换问题,尤其是在C++中,常见的有`char *`、`std::string`等不同形式的字符串表示。本篇将重点讨论如何利用`std::string`进行数据类型转换,并分析...

    CString string char 之间的相互转换

    char* string_to_char(std::string str) char* string_to_char_Ex(std::string& str) template void other_to_string(T value,std::string& s) int CString_unicode_to_char(CString str,char* buff) CString char_...

    CString,int,string,char之间的转换

    `CString`、`int`、`std::string`、`char`及`char*`之间的转换涉及到不同的方法和注意事项,正确理解和运用这些转换规则对于避免潜在的错误和提升代码效率至关重要。通过本文的详细介绍,希望开发者能够更加熟练地...

    VC中CString,int,string,char*之间的转换

    VC 中 CString、int、string、char* 之间的转换 CString、int、string、char* 是四种常用的数据类型,在 VC 中它们之间的转换非常常见,本文将详细介绍它们之间的转换方法以及应用实例。 string 转 CString 使用 ...

    char,string全部函数方法说明

    在Java编程语言中,`char`和`String`是处理文本数据的关键类型。`char`代表单个字符,而`String`则用于存储一串字符。本文将详细介绍`char`和`String`相关的函数方法,帮助新手更好地理解和使用它们。 对于`char`...

    S7-1200中将BYTE类型数据转换成char类型数据的具体方法.docx

    Char_TO_Strg指令是TIA博途中用于将char类型数据转换成STRING的指令。在使用时,需要指定pChars参数,即从哪个字符开始转换,以及Cnt参数,即要转换的字符数量。在这个例子中,我们将转换整个char数组。 然而,当你...

    string与char*转换的使用详解

    在C++程序中,经常需要在`string` 和`char*` 之间进行转换,以便于在不同API或函数之间传递字符串。下面我们将详细探讨这两种类型之间的转换方法。 ### 1. `string` 转 `const char*` `string` 类型的实例有一个...

    CString,int,string,char之间的转换.txt

    本文将详细介绍 CString、int、string 和 char 之间的相互转换方法,并提供具体的示例代码。 #### 一、概述 在 C++ 中,字符串通常有多种表示形式,包括 `CString`(MFC 中的字符串类)、`std::string`(C++ 标准...

Global site tag (gtag.js) - Google Analytics